Traditional Mud Cloth (Bogolanfini)
Origin: Mali, West Africa

This authentic mud cloth is created using a labor-intensive process passed down through generations. Hand-spun cotton is woven into narrow strips—each approximately 5" wide—and then stitched together to form a wrap-sized textile, traditionally worn as a skirt or lapa.

The entire cloth is dyed in a tea made from the bark of the Bogalon tree, which acts as a natural fixative for the hand-painted designs applied with specially prepared mud. Each piece is completely handmade, making it truly one of a kind.
